DUTHIE, Walter
, was b. London, Eng., in 1878, and is a son of Rev. W. N.
Duthie, Rector at Hespeler, who came to Canada in 1866. Mr. Duthie is
Manager of the Union Bank of Canada in Hillsburgh, Erin Tp. He is a member of
the English church and a Conservative. He m. Miss Breckel, of Smith's
Falls.
The Union Bank was established in Erin in 1902, and in 1905 the branch was started in Hillsburgh under the management of Mr. Duthie. The Union Bank was incorporated in 1865 under the Canadian Banking Act. It has over 100 branches, and is developing very fast under the general management of George A. Balfour. The total assets of the bank, July, 1905, were over $22,000,000; paid-up capital $2,500,000; reserved, $1,100,000. The head office is in the city of Quebec, and it is one of the most substantial and accommodating banks in Canada. From: Historical Atlas of the County of Wellington, Ontario. Toronto:Historical Atlas Publishing Co., 1906 |
